Regina Cemetery Tour – https://reginacemeterytours.ca/

I’m excited about the Regina Cemetery Tour! In September, Kenton tends to also have flashlight tours. If you want some extra spooky evening tours of the Regina Cemetery, then you’ll have to go a month early. Some years, he goes into October, so check it out!

Come out and learn more about the history of Regina, while walking amongst Regina’s past residents. Learn the history of a couple of Regina’s ghosts (which I included in YQR Haunts: Guide to Ghosts of Regina)!

Ghost Story Tours at Government House – https://governmenthousesk.ca/events

I love any event at the Government House! I noticed that this year, they have two Halloween events going on. Go grab your tickets before they are sold out! 

The Ghost Story Tours allows you to explore the Government House in the evening and learn about haunted experiences by the staff of Government House. I’ve been to a similar event before – it’s a fun experience! 

Victorian Supernatural Séance at Government House – https://governmenthousesk.ca/events

The second event that is being held at the Government House this year is the Victoria Supernatural Séance. I haven’t been to this one myself, so if you go, I’d love to hear your experience! 

Attend the theatrical séance performance by the “medium” as they try to reach out to the spirits that roam the rooms in the Government House. Maybe “Howie” will say hi!
